1. Night Vision Scope

1.1 Overview:

Night Vision Scopes are optical devices designed to amplify existing light, including infrared light, to provide enhanced visibility in low-light conditions. They are widely used in military, law enforcement, hunting, and recreational activities.

1.2 Key Features:

  • Image Intensifier Tube: Core component that amplifies ambient light.
  • Infrared Illuminator: Enhances visibility in complete darkness.
  • Magnification: Variable levels for zooming in on targets.
  • Reticle Options: Various reticle patterns for targeting.
  • Range: Different scopes offer different effective ranges.

1.3 Applications:

  • Military Operations: Used for reconnaissance, surveillance, and targeting.
  • Law Enforcement: Employed in night patrols and surveillance.
  • Hunting: Popular for nocturnal hunting, especially for feral hogs and predators.
  • Recreational Use: Utilized in camping and wildlife observation.

1.4 Advantages:

  • Enhanced Visibility: Provides clear images in low-light and total darkness.
  • Zoom Capabilities: Variable magnification for different scenarios.
  • Infrared Capability: Can operate in complete darkness with the help of infrared illumination.
  • Diverse Applications: Suitable for a wide range of activities.

2. Red Light

2.1 Overview:

Red lights are often used in low-light conditions to provide illumination without compromising the user’s night vision. They are popular in various activities, including astronomy, map reading, and general navigation.

2.2 Key Features:

  • Low Light Impact: Red light has a minimal impact on night vision.
  • Adjustable Brightness: Many red lights have adjustable brightness settings.
  • Battery Efficiency: Red lights typically consume less power than white lights.
  • Filter Options: Some lights offer red filters for additional customization.

2.3 Applications:

  • Astronomy: Used by astronomers to preserve night vision while observing celestial objects.
  • Map Reading: Red light aids in reading maps without causing glare.
  • Night Photography: Red light is less likely to disrupt the exposure settings of cameras.
  • Military and Tactical Use: In some situations, red lights are used for discreet illumination.

2.4 Advantages:

  • Preservation of Night Vision: Red light minimally affects the user’s night vision.
  • Battery Efficiency: Consumes less power compared to white light.
  • Versatility: Applicable in various scenarios without causing excessive glare.
  • Adjustable Brightness: Users can customize the brightness level based on their needs.

3. Green Light

3.1 Overview:

Similar to red lights, green lights are used in low-light conditions for illumination without compromising night vision. They have specific advantages and applications that make them preferred in certain scenarios.

3.2 Key Features:

  • Contrast and Clarity: Green light provides good contrast and clarity in low-light environments.
  • Adjustable Brightness: Many green lights come with adjustable brightness settings.
  • Enhanced Distance Visibility: Some users find that green light offers better visibility at longer distances.
  • Battery Efficiency: Green lights often consume less power than white lights.

3.3 Applications:

  • Hunting: Green lights are popular for hunting as they can be effective without spooking certain animals.
  • Night Vision Devices: Some night vision users prefer green light for its contrast and clarity.
  • Search and Rescue: Green light can provide good visibility in search and rescue operations.
  • Tactical Use: In some military and tactical situations, green light is used for discreet illumination.

3.4 Advantages:

  • Contrast and Clarity: Green light offers good visibility in low-light conditions.
  • Adjustable Brightness: Users can customize the brightness level for different scenarios.
  • Enhanced Distance Visibility: Some users find that green light is effective at longer distances.
  • Battery Efficiency: Consumes less power compared to white lights.

4. Comparative Analysis: Night Vision Scope vs. Red Light vs. Green Light

4.1 Impact on Night Vision:

  • Night Vision Scope: Enhances and enables night vision with the help of image intensifier technology.
  • Red Light: Minimally impacts night vision, making it suitable for tasks that require preserved night vision.
  • Green Light: Provides good visibility while still preserving night vision, especially at longer distances.

4.2 Applications:

  • Night Vision Scope: Versatile, suitable for various activities including military, law enforcement, hunting, and recreation.
  • Red Light: Used in astronomy, map reading, night photography, and situations where minimal impact on night vision is crucial.
  • Green Light: Popular in hunting, certain night vision applications, search and rescue, and tactical situations.

4.3 Illumination Range:

  • Night Vision Scope: The effective range depends on the specific scope, with some models offering extended ranges.
  • Red Light: Typically used for close-range tasks without causing glare.
  • Green Light: Can be effective at longer distances compared to red light.

4.4 Battery Efficiency:

  • Night Vision Scope: Power consumption varies, often higher due to image intensifier technology and infrared illuminators.
  • Red Light: Generally consumes less power compared to white lights, contributing to longer battery life.
  • Green Light: Like red lights, green lights are often more battery-efficient than white lights.

4.5 Versatility:

  • Night Vision Scope: Highly versatile, suitable for a wide range of activities and scenarios.
  • Red Light: Versatile for specific tasks like astronomy, map reading, and photography.
  • Green Light: Versatile, especially in hunting and scenarios where good visibility at a distance is crucial.
